The document analyzes the cinematography in the opening car crash scene of a film. It discusses 8 cuts in the scene. The first few cuts are slow to establish the characters and their relationships. The pace of cuts then speeds up to emphasize the suddenness and violence of the crash, using very brief shots under a second to show the collision and metal rods smashing through the windshield. The final long crane shot allows viewers to comprehend the full extent of the crash.
